Automatic Generation of 3D Caricatures Based on Artistic Deformation Styles
IEEE Transactions on Visualization and Computer Graphics, Volume: 17, Issue: 6, Pages: 808 - 821

Abstract
Caricatures combines humour and art in a visual way. This work demonstrates a fun, semi-automatic pipeline to produce 3D caricatures from photographs, also addressing some of the undesirable 2D artifacts. A pseudo stress-strain model is used to make the caricatures more realistic.
